Abstract

676,133. Electric resonators. BRITISH THOMSON-HOUSTON CO., Ltd., and SCOTT, W. J. Feb. 9, 1951 [Feb. 9, 1950], No. 3358/50. Class 40 (viii). An electrically resonant window 1, e.g. of glass, is provided with an adjustable tuning member 3 so located in the electro - dynamic field of the window as to be capable of changing its resonant frequency. The tuning member of Fig. 2 is of metal tipped with glass 7 and is formed with a kink 5 to allow a small amount of adjustability. In Fig. 3 the window 1 forms part of the wall of e.g. a transmitreceive or transmitter-blocker cell and the tuning member, which is in the form of a glass rod 8 having a metal insert 9, is adjusted from the outside by means of a screw 13 and nuts 15. In order to provide a flexible support for the rod 8, the wall is reduced in thickness as shown at 11. Specifications 582,328, 587,812 and 654,668 are referred to.
